Review: Laduree’s Summer Garden in Burlington Arcade

Review: Laduree’s Summer Garden in Burlington Arcade

Located in Burlington Arcade in Piccadilly, Laduree’s Summer Garden is an elegantly designed corner with its floral décor and pastel-shaded cart reminiscent of quaint French eateries. Its visual charm aside, the menu... Read more »